Ishan Kishan smashes maiden century as India beat New Zealand in final T20I

Ishan Kishan smashed a maiden T20I century to help India power to a 46-run win in the fifth and final game against New Zealand, and seal a 4-1 series victory in Thiruvananthapuram.

Batting at number three, Kishan struck 103 from just 43 balls as the home team went to a mammoth total of 271-5 in their 20 overs.

The left-handed Kishan hit 10 sixes and six fours in his knock and received good support from his captain Suryakumar Yadav (63 off 30), Hardik Pandya (42 off 17) and Abhishek Sharma (30 off 16).

New Zealand's bowlers were put to the sword in the first innings with fast bowler Lockie Ferguson returning the best figures of 2-41 his four overs.

The Black Caps made a good fist of the huge run-chase with opener Finn Allen striking 80 off 38 deliveries while Rachin Ravindra contributed 30.

Ish Sodhi stroked a lusty 33 off 15 balls towards the end of the contest as India seamer Arsheep Singh ended with 5-51 in his four overs.

Both teams will take valuable information and preparations start for the T20 World Cup that kicks off on 7 February.
